O K,
Ya take this.....



Get rid of the [IMG], and the [/IMG].
Next, take this....http://i41.photobucket.com/albums/e297/icanfixitforyou/100_2634.jpg , and copy.
Now click in the post window where ya want the pic to show, then click on the . Now a window opens in the upper left of the screen. Delete the http// that is there, and paste the... http://i41.photobucket.com/albums/e297/icanfixitforyou/100_2634.jpg in it's place. Click on OK, and the pic will appear.

While the engine was out I installed a really high quality rebuilt steering box from a guy named Gary in Connecticut. The steering box made a TON of difference in how my 'Vette handles. Take my advice - fellow forum members - beware of ANY over the counter rebuilt steering boxes, even from the big name companies, and some of the new steering boxes too.
